Transaction 2c56a6ce955f66df8396fdab4e21ccb4f070eaad96c84e394a3cf478d91b9beb

8 Input
2 Outputs
  • 2c56a6ce955f66df8396fdab4e21ccb4f070eaad96c84e394a3cf478d91b9beb:0
  • value  817693
    address  16AR1uKMrh2nekCSg9ouA9Rbyhe4UdQVML
  • 2c56a6ce955f66df8396fdab4e21ccb4f070eaad96c84e394a3cf478d91b9beb:1
  • value  16508583
    address  3NMuqPPUt8edyqar4W3pcEvVUWTvfPPV8V